# ChipGate Environments

ChipGate is the timing-chip reader service for the Vestrum Marathon series. Three environments: dev (fake chip pings), staging (replayed race data), and prod (live mats at the start and finish arches). If readers go quiet mid-race, check staging first — it mirrors prod closely. Prod values differ in a few sneaky ways, so here's the current prod configuration.

settings of yahag-yafog:
[pramir]
host = pramir.qirvancorp.internal
user = pramir_svc
database = pramir_prod

**Digest Scheduling — Contractor Onboarding**

Batch email digests on Quellbird run hourly via the Tidewire scheduler. Edit cadence in `digest.yml`; never trigger manual sends outside the 06:00–22:00 window. Staging mirrors prod schedules one hour behind. If the scheduler account locks after a failed deploy, recovery is self-serve. Unlock it with the passphrase below.

vault phrase of bagaf-kajeg = jorath-feniel-briir-siliel-ralix

## Releases

Heads up, support folks: release 4.2 of Brindlewick finishes the big ORM refactor. The old Quillbase data layer is gone, so those weird lazy-loading tickets should dry up. If a customer reports duplicate rows after upgrading, it's almost certainly a stale migration — point them at the rerun script. Builds are published weekly from the release branch. Every artifact is verified against the key below before shipping.

rollout seal: bky4_x7Gc